    "content": "Hon. Temporary Deputy Speaker, I support the Copyright (Amendment) Bill 2017. We know when individuals are left to do things on their own, they do not safeguard their venture into businesses and other areas of expertise. So, when we do not protect people, we kill initiatives and innovations and produce substandard goods and services in our nation. We know what is happening. There is a lady from Uasin Gishu County who was number five worldwide in the beauty contest. We are going to celebrate her next week because she was left to work in a conducive and free environment. Her life is going to change. So, the youth in this nation are venturing into music and we should protect them so that they do the right things. The Bible tells us: “Out of your own sweat, you will produce bread.” So, you should not eat out of somebody’s sweat. Innovators in our nation should be left to work in a free and conducive environment. We should have laws to protect what they are doing. In the academic world, we talk about plagiarism. You cannot uplift even two sentences from somebody’s work without quoting the source. So, musicians and other people who have talents in other areas should be protected the way students in universities are protected. They produce their own work. You cannot copy without quoting the author. I support this Motion because the socio-economic development of our nation will be realised when we protect people who have worked hard to produce whatever they have produced. I support this Bill.
